- Jose E. Feliciano cofounded Clearlake Capital in 2006 with Behdad Eghbali; both are managing partners.
- Clearlake Capital has more than $90 billion in assets under management; it has scored some of the industry's best returns.
- The firm is known for buying software, industrial and consumer products companies. In 2022, Clearlake joined billionaire investor Todd Boehly to buy English soccer team Chelsea FC.
- Feliciano worked in investment banking at Goldman Sachs and was the chief financial officer of govWorks before it declared bankruptcy in 2000.
- Feliciano, who was born in Puerto Rico, is on the board of trustees of Stanford University and the Smithsonian National Museum of the American Latino.
- Feliciano and his wife have committed $50 million in grants and impact investments to support entrepreneurs from underrepresented groups.
